Through Hole Resistors
Through hole resistors, also known as "THR" or "through-hole" resistors, are an important type of electrical component used in a wide variety of electrical and electronic circuits. A through-hole resistor is a resistive element constructed of two metal leads that are inserted into plated-through holes in a printed circuit board (PCB). The two leads are connected together by a dielectric material sandwiched between them. Through hole resistors are used in applications ranging from low-power audio and video systems to high-power electronic devices such as radios, cell phones, and computers.The most common type of through-hole resistor is the carbon film resistor. As the name implies, this type of resistor is constructed of a thin film of carbon material that is deposited onto a ceramic substrate. The carbon film is then selectively etched to form the resistive element. Carbon film resistors are a cost-effective, stable, and reliable method of providing resistance.Another common type of through-hole resistor is the wirewound resistor. These resistors are constructed from an insulated resistance wire, such as nickel-chromium-iron (Nichrome) or copper-chromium-iron (Chromeline). The wire is wound onto a ceramic or metal form, and then the coils are soldered to the PCB.
